A Legacy on the Water

It is, like, pretty impressive to think that Ross Lake Resort has been welcoming guests since 1952. That is a long time for a place to be operating, especially one that floats on water. This long history means they really know what they are doing when it comes to providing a good experience in this remote setting. They have, in a way, perfected the art of hospitality on the lake.

The fact that it is comprised of fifteen floating cabins and a marina is, you know, what truly sets it apart. These are not just regular buildings; they are designed to float, which requires a special kind of attention. The team there, apparently, keeps a close watch on things, especially as the lake level changes throughout the fall, winter, and spring. They typically keep a skeleton crew of three or four people to shovel snow and adjust things, which shows how dedicated they are to keeping the place running.

This long-standing presence means the resort has, frankly, become a part of the lake's story. It offers a kind of old-school charm combined with the sheer wonder of being on the water. It is, basically, the only lodging available in the Ross Lake area, which makes it even more sought after. On the Water: Boating, Paddling, Fishing

Ross Lake is, obviously, the main attraction here, and there are countless ways to enjoy it from the water. The resort currently rents motorboats, canoes, kayaks, and SUPs. This means you do not have to bring your own gear to get out onto the lake, which is, I mean, pretty helpful for travelers.

If you are into fishing, you are in luck, because they also rent fishing rods. Whether you are an experienced angler or just want to try it out, the lake offers opportunities to cast a line. It is, basically, a very peaceful way to spend an afternoon, just drifting on the water and waiting for a bite. The quiet of the lake is, arguably, quite calming.

Securing Your Stay: The Lottery System

If you are hoping to stay at one of the floating cabins, you will need to know about their accommodation lottery. This is, basically, how most people get a chance to book a cabin, as it is the only lodging in the Ross Lake area. It is, in a way, a fair system that gives everyone a shot at experiencing this truly unique spot.

To join the accommodation lottery, you will need to click here. This is your first step towards potentially securing a stay at the resort. It is, frankly, a popular place, so getting in on the lottery is key. The resort's 2025 season, for example, runs from June 5th through October 31st, so you will want to be aware of those dates when planning your lottery entry.

Because it is so remote and so unique, bookings are, you know, highly sought after. So, do not be discouraged if it takes a few tries to get a spot.
